Professional Profile: Ovsyannikova Y.

Ovsyannikova Y. is a distinguished official judge recognized by the Russian Kynological Federation, serving as a pivotal figure within the canine evaluation sector. With comprehensive licensure covering all ten FCI groups, this judge possesses an expansive breadth of knowledge that spans from the specialized requirements of Group 1 herding dogs to the refined elegance of Group 9 companion animals. Her professional mandate involves the rigorous assessment of canine morphology, ensuring that every participant adheres strictly to the established standards that define the functional and aesthetic integrity of each canine variety.

Core Judging Criteria

  • Movement and Gait Analysis: Evaluation of the dog's efficiency, reach, and drive, ensuring that the gait is consistent with the functional requirements of the specific breed.
  • Anatomical Balance and Proportions: Assessment of skeletal structure, including angulation, bone density, and the overall harmony of the dog's silhouette.
  • Breed Type and Expression: Examination of head properties, including the skull-to-muzzle ratio, eye placement, and the distinct character that defines the breed's unique identity.
  • Temperament and Ring Demeanor: Observation of the dog's confidence, stability, and willingness to engage, which are essential indicators of a sound canine psyche.
